Comprehending Antenuptial Agreements: What They Are and Why They Issue
Antenuptial agreements, generally described as prenuptial arrangements, act as essential legal instruments for couples preparing to marry. These agreements delineate the financial and residential property legal rights of each companion in case of divorce or separation. They aim to minimize disputes and provide clarity regarding asset circulation, therefore fostering a complacency within the partnership. Furthermore, antenuptial contracts can address concerns such as spousal assistance and financial obligations, guaranteeing both parties understand their duties. By detailing expectations and responsibilities prior to going into marriage, pairs can promote open communication and good understanding. Such contracts are particularly important for people with considerable properties, service rate of interests, or children from previous partnerships, as they assist protect domestic and personal interests in the future.

Debt Duties Allotment
While several couples concentrate on property division in their antenuptial contracts, the allotment of financial obligation responsibilities is just as vital. Developing clear guidelines concerning financial obligation can avoid misconceptions and disputes during a marital relationship or in case of a separation. Couples ought to identify which financial obligations are specific and which are joint, defining exactly how each will be taken care of. This includes charge card debts, financings, and any monetary responsibilities incurred before marriage. By doing so, they can safeguard themselves from acquiring a companion's economic burdens. Furthermore, it is smart to assess future debts and lay out exactly how they will be handled. Eventually, a distinct financial obligation responsibility provision can foster financial transparency and promote a healthier monetary partnership.
Spousal Assistance Stipulations
Establishing clear debt duties lays a strong structure for going over spousal support conditions in an antenuptial contract. Spousal assistance clauses detail the economic responsibilities one partner might have to the various other in the occasion of separation or splitting up. These stipulations can specify the duration and amount of assistance, thinking about variables such as income disparity, length of marital relationship, and the recipient's demands. Couples might tailor these arrangements to reflect their one-of-a-kind conditions, making certain clearness and fairness. In addition, spousal assistance stipulations can deal with modifications based upon adjustments in monetary condition or life occasions. By consisting of these details, pairs can alleviate prospective disputes and develop a more equitable framework for their monetary future.

Lawful Factors To Consider and Requirements for Antenuptial Dealings
While drafting an antenuptial contract can be a necessary action for couples, it is necessary to comprehend the lawful factors to consider and requirements that govern such contracts. Normally, these agreements have to be in writing and signed by both parties to be enforceable. Furthermore, they typically call for complete economic disclosure to assure justness and openness. Lawful advise is advisable to navigate specific jurisdictional laws, as requirements may vary significantly. Celebrations must likewise think about the timing of the contract; ideally, it ought to be performed well before the wedding my sources to avoid claims of threat. Inevitably, recognizing these lawful components can assist couples create a binding and effective antenuptial contract that shields their passions.

Are Antenuptial Contracts Enforceable in All States?
Antenuptial agreements are normally enforceable in a lot of states, provided they fulfill particular lawful demands. However, variants in state legislations may influence their enforceability, requiring couples to speak with attorneys for guidance customized to their jurisdiction.
Just how much Does It Typically Cost to Create One?
The typical price to produce an antenuptial agreement varies, usually varying from $1,000 to $3,000. Aspects influencing the price include intricacy, lawyer charges, and the certain needs of both parties included.
